Output 673ab39299ad4c213891d9f2202a9c01fa9e739a5171321b47fc7a1df6116058:3

value
29204606
script pubkey
OP_0 OP_PUSHBYTES_20 23bd568a5dc10cd431072648f893579ed7b12bd2
address
ltc1qyw74dzjacyxdgvg8yey03y6hnmtmz27j5vvyzg
transaction
673ab39299ad4c213891d9f2202a9c01fa9e739a5171321b47fc7a1df6116058
spent
true